COVID-19 Impact on Student Learning: Grade-Level Readiness Matters

Overview
Published: February 2022
While students who are falling behind in a typical school year often get extra help and show greater growth, the pandemic resulted in many students falling even further behind. This research study examines how the effects of COVID-19 impacted student growth. What are the differences in student outcomes in pre-pandemic cohorts versus after? We examine factors such as initial grade-level placement, student demographics, and learning environment.
